- [ ] **Step 7: Breaker override escrow.** After sealing the signing keys for the Tallgrove upstream API circuit breaker, confirm the support team can force the breaker open during a full outage. The override bundle lives in the sealed escrow drawer and is useless without its unlock phrase. Two ceremony witnesses must initial this step before proceeding. The escrow bundle is decrypted with the recovery passphrase that follows.

vault phrase of kahip-kahop = holath-quenmir

Action item PM-14: Plugin authors for the Wrenwiki platform must stop requesting the legacy editor-all role, which contributed to the March incident by granting write access across restricted spaces. Going forward, declare the minimal space-scoped roles your plugin needs in its manifest; submissions requesting broader access will be rejected during review. The updated role taxonomy, manifest examples, and migration deadlines are published on the internal page below.

dashboard of yahaf-kajep = https://jira.zemvarsys.internal/display/projects/browse/browse/a08b

Subject: Payroll export cut-over — done

Hi — quick recap since you're just joining. We switched Paylarch's export from the legacy fixed-width format to the new delimited spec on Monday night. Cut-over went cleanly; two tenants needed a re-run due to stale templates, both fixed. Old format is fully retired. So you know what the exporter is running with now, the active settings are these.

service settings:
[silwyn]
host = silwyn.crelvogrid.internal
user = silwyn_svc
database = silwyn_prod